Okay the one I had but replaced with a Mongoose looks exactly the same made by euroflow but doesn't have the small cat like box, I had to have a Cat fitted as well.

The top picture shows the box I haven't got are you sure it's included?

Reason I changed to Mongoose was that ever since it was fitted it seemed to effect the running from cold, hard to explain but felt like the car was suddenly being held back, I described it as feeling like someone had lassooed the car, next second it was fine. I changed just about every sensor but the problem continued until I changed the exhaust now no issues at all.
I also failed the MOT on emissions due to the rubbish CAT I had but it's hard to find one half decent, they are either very cheap or Toyota price £600, hence why I have another cheap one which passed the MOT this year.

The fit was good but oddly on cold morning you get nearly all the steam out of just the right pipe which again made me feel something not right with the exhaust.

Hope it was just mine and yours is okay.
